45 / 154 page ![]() WM8235 Rev 4.6 45 PROGRAMMABLE AUTOMATIC BLACK LEVEL CALIBRATION (BLC) The Programmable Automatic Black-Level Calibration (BLC) function is to adjust the D.C. offset of the output data such that the digital output code for black pixels is calibrated to a target black level value. The D.C. offset is determined during the optically-black pixels at the beginning of the linear sensor and removed during the image-pixels as shown in Figure 27. Black Pixel Period Image Pixel Period Determine Black Level Offset Remove Black Level Offset from Image Pixels Figure 27 Linear Sensor Model The automatic black level calibration operates assuming 12-bits ADC resolution. Adjustments to calculations must be made for different ADC resolutions. The black level calibration process occurs in two stages as shown in Figure 28 below: Coarse Adjust Calibration - This is a mixed signal loop which removes the coarse offset by adjusting the offset DAC. Fine Adjust Calibration - This is a digital loop which removes the remaining offset with better noise tolerance, utilising ADC over-range to improve the dynamic range of the system. TARGET BL Input Black Level V1 Adjusted ADC Output PGA ADC Offset DAC Mixed Signal LOOP Digits Coarse Adjust Calibration Fine Adjust Calibration Digital LOOP Digits Figure 28 BLC Top-Level Circuitry TARGET CODES The user must specify a target black level for each channel through the registers TARGETINP*. If, during the black-pixel period, the average ADC output code was, for example, 100 and the user specified the target black level code to be 10, the BLC circuitry would determine 90 codes should be subtracted from the ADC output. These 90 codes will then be subtracted from every image-pixel code output from the ADC. Note: Changing the PGA gain affects the black-level through the device; the gain should therefore not be changed during a BLC procedure. If the PGA gain changes, then the BLC routine should be re- run. The automatic black level calibration feature operates with the assumption of a 12-bit ADC resolution.
